Job Description What You’ll Be Doing Collaborating with business users to define new application requirements.

Developing, testing, and maintaining clean, performant code for client applications.

Supporting project delivery alongside Project Managers and senior developers.

Working as part of a close-knit team to deliver solutions on time and on budget.

Analysing large-scale time-series data and generating actionable reports.

Mentoring junior developers and contributing to a culture of learning.

Qualifications What You Bring 2+ years of hands-on kdb+ development experience.

Solid understanding of q language and time-series data structures.

Experience working in Unix/Linux environments.

Strong logical thinking and problem-solving skills.

Familiarity with software development methodologies and the SDLC.

Comfortable working independently and collaboratively within a team.

Excellent client-facing communication skills.

Prior experience of working in Capital Markets/Investment Banking is a plus but not essential Bonus Skills (Not Required): Experience in Capital Markets or Investment Banking.

Knowledge of Python, cloud platforms, or other time-series databases.

Exposure to project leadership or people management.

Contribution to internal tools, documentation, or community initiatives.

About Us Data Intellect is a specialist data and technology consultancy with deep roots in capital markets.

We build high-performance systems that power trading, risk, and analytics for some of the world’s most demanding clients.

Our expertise spans kdb+, data engineering, regulatory tech, and enterprise platforms and we’re growing fast.
